Effects of the Sill Downstream• No significant changes in ground-water levels at wells downgradient.
• No significant change in concentrations of water-quality constituents in flows at the sill.
• The sill increased the base water levels immediately upstream of the sill by 6 ft.• No significant changes in water levels downstream from the sill.
• The sill decreased the peak flows from the sill to Fargo, Georgia.
• The sill increased the base flows downstream as far as Blue Sink.
